SB 489: Local agency formation commissions: written policies and procedures: Permit Streamlining Act: housing development projects.

California · Senate · 2025–2026 Regular Session · last verified December 7, 2025

What SB 489 does, verified December 7, 2025

This bill aims to improve local government development patterns by requiring local agency formation commissions to establish written policies and procedures. These policies must include forms for various submittals and be accessible to the public through an internet website. The bill also requires commissions to provide access to notices and other information about public hearings and meetings. Additionally, the bill mandates that public agencies publish online lists of required information for housing development projects, including the criteria for determining completeness and the type of approval. This bill imposes a state-mandated local program by increasing the duties of local agencies. However, no reimbursement is required for the costs associated with implementing this bill.
